cassandra中的分区计数

Posted

技术标签:

【中文标题】cassandra中的分区计数【英文标题】:Partition count in cassandra 【发布时间】:2018-11-16 07:18:13 【问题描述】:

tablestats 查询中的分区数(估计)表示什么? 当我们在多节点 cassandra 的不同节点查询 tablestats 时,我们看到每个节点的稳定计数和分区数的值不同。这是否表示特定节点的行数/分区键数?

【问题讨论】:

【参考方案1】:

是的,这表示给定节点上特定表的多个分区。不同的分区数量可能是因为你的表中的数据分布、该节点拥有的 vnode 数量等。

【讨论】:

在这种情况下,分区是否等同于令牌/行 token 与具体的分区有关。但是如果您定义了聚类列,则分区可能有很多行...

以上是关于cassandra中的分区计数的主要内容,如果未能解决你的问题,请参考以下文章

cassandra 中的地理感知分区

Cassandra 分区键可以跨一个键空间中的多个表吗?

Cassandra 不均匀分区和热点

添加新服务器时对 Cassandra 中的数据进行重新分区

Cassandra中的行键

Spring Data Cassandra 计数器更新